摘要
Development of semiconductor technology has led to a concept of System-on-Chip (SoC). Complexity of modern applications and deep-submicron technologies make low power design attitude compulsory. The higher the level of abstraction of a design at which power optimizations are applied, the higher are potential savings. In this paper we present an overview of some of the design measures to reduce energy consumption of SoCs.
